Service Level Agreements (SLAs) are formal agreements between service providers and customers that define the expected level of service, outlining specific metrics, responsibilities, and expectations for both parties. SLAs are crucial for establishing clear communication and accountability in service delivery, particularly in logistics and supply chain management, where timely and efficient order fulfillment is vital for customer satisfaction.
